Kuwait Stock Exchange (KSE) started action Wednesday in the red zone, with the weighted index shedding 2.34 points, the price index went down by 33.04 points, and the KSX 15 index, which reflects trading in blue-chips, dropped by 6.92 points, by 9:15 a.m.
Value of transactions reached KD 9.68 million, changing hands of 158.9 million shares in 1,745 transactions.
Top volume shares were those of (INVESTORS), (GFH), (MAYADEEN), (MANAZEL), and (ADNC).
Meanwhile, (MTCC), (FCEM), (QCEM), (SULTAN), and (ADNC) stocks were top gainers.
